Step 1. Create An Ad Account

When you sign up for Facebook, the social media site gives your personal ad account an ID by default. You can see this number in Ads Manager and look at its upper left corner where it says “ID” or something similar to that. In order to use Facebook Ads Manager, you need a verified payment method and:

If you do not have a Page for your business, you can follow Facebook’s steps to set one up. Any Page you create will be automatically given an ad account.

If there is a Page you wish to advertise for that was created by someone else, you need to ask the Page admin to assign you an admin, editor, or advertiser role on the Page.

You can create a new ad account for your Page by signing up with the Business Manager.

A business manager will be able to help you get the most out of advertising on Facebook, including setting up an ads campaign and monitoring its performance in real-time – all while staying within budget!

Step 3. Choose Your Objective

Get started with your first ad, click the green ‘Create’ button.

07-Facebook beginners guide

Facebook will take you to a page where you will be prompted to choose a campaign objective.

08-Facebook beginners guide

You have many different ways of approaching an ad campaign based on what you wish to achieve. These ways fall within 6 type categories of benefits:

Your campaign objective is the business goal you hope to achieve by running your ads. Hover over each one for more information.

  • Awareness Show your ads to people who are most likely to remember them. Good for:
    • Reach
    • Brand awareness
    • Video views
  • Traffic Send people to a destination, like your website, app or Facebook event. Good for:
    • Link clicks
    • Landing page views
  • Engagement Get more messages, video views, post engagement, Page likes or event responses. Good for:
    • Massages
    • Video Views
    • Post engagement
  • Leads Collect leads for your business or brand. Good For:
    • Instant forms
    • Messages
    • Calls
    • Sign-ups
  • App Promotion Find new people to install your app and continue using it. Good for:
    • App installs
    • App Events
  • Sales Find people likely to purchase your product or service. Good for
    • Conversion
    • Catalog sales
    • Messages

Step 4: Set Your Campaign Budget

You’ve set your budget and now it is time to choose how much you would like to spend on ads. You can either do this per day or as the total amount for the campaign.

  • The daily budget sets a limit on what you spend each day on your ads. Facebook will use the criteria set in order to find the right place and time of showing these advertisements so that they can reach out to potential customers who are most likely going through their shopping lists at this moment!

Daily budget

  • Lifetime budgets are a great way to make sure you don’t overspend. Facebook offers lifetime campaigns, where the maximum spend per day is determined by your ad network and lasts until one date in time has passed or all funds have been used up – whichever comes first!

Lifetime Budget

Step 5: Customise Your Target Audience

Because it determines who Facebook will show your ad to, a strategically defined audience is crucial for the success of your Facebook Ads campaigns. As mentioned earlier, the audience for your ad can be customized based on all the following demographics:

12-Facebook beginners guide

  • Location: Targeting specific countries and regions is a great way to increase the profitability of your campaigns. Simply start typing in any country that you want on the list, then click “Add” when finished!
  • Gender: You can choose whether or not you want your ad to be targeted at a specific gender. If the product being sold is specifically for one sex, this option helps avoid wasting money on targeting people in another category who might not care about what’s being offered!
  • Age: Select the minimum and maximum age of the target audience.
  • Behaviours, Interests: Fine-tune your target audience by choosing demographics, interests and behaviours. When you click on the edit button, you will be able to start searching for specific details
  • Languages: By selecting the language you want to appear only in your ad, Facebook will show it only if people speak that particular dialect. If unsure about this option just leave it at default so everyone can see ads!

In addition, with the Connections setting, you can choose advanced targeting, which lets you include or exclude people who are connected to certain pages, apps, or events. You can also further customize your targeting using custom audiences for retargeting people who have already interacted with your business.

Step 6: Choose Your Ad Placements

Ad placement defines where your ad appears for your target audience. Based on your objective, you may choose to show your ad on Facebook, Instagram, Messenger, or the Audience Network.

Creating a new ad

If you want to start from scratch, the first step is selecting a Facebook ad format. You’ve probably seen all of these different options on your personal feed but they will vary depending on what objective.

18-Facebook beginners guide

Facebook has eight ad formats learn more, and it will recommend one or more to you based on your campaign objective.

Photo ads: A single image is enough to make an impact on consumers, which makes photo ads a great choice for advertising. You can use these simple ad types and placements in any number of ways – they’re not limited by what you see here!

Facebook’s specs for photo ads

19-Facebook beginners guide

Video Ads: Video ads are a great way to get your product or service in front of people. The news feed has moving images, so this type of advertising will stand out more than other forms on social media sites like Facebook and Twitter!

Facebook’s specs for video ads

video ad

Carousel Ads: Showcasing up to 10 videos or images in one single ad, these are good to promote multiple products or services, each with its own link.

Facebook specs for carousel ads

carousel ad spec

Slideshow Ads are perfect for people who don’t have the time or expertise to make videos. These ad formats take several images and turn them into a quick slideshow, giving you more room in your budget!

Messenger ads are the most effective way to reach your target audience with Meta’s Messenger app.

Collection Ads are the perfect way to show off all your favourite items at once. This format is also mobile-only and allows users to explore for products, so you can shop in style no matter where life takes them!

Facebook specs for collection ads

22-Facebook beginners guide

Stories ads: There are no limits to the creativity of these ads, which pop up when someone is watching Facebook stories or Instagram videos. With so much freedom it’s hard not to have an idea!

Playable Ads: These ads allow potential users to try an app before they buy it.
